Virola peruviana

(Virola peruviana)

Description

Virola peruviana is a species of tree in the Myristicaceae family. It is found in Brazil (Amazonas, Pará), Colombia, Ecuador and Peru. It grows to a height of about 35 m (100 ft). The fruit is ellipsoidal, 14–24 mm long and 11–23 mm in diameter, forming groups of about 5 to 15.
